黑狐家游戏

关系数据库关系的性质有哪些,关系数据库有哪些性质

欧气 2 0

关系数据库的性质及其重要性

一、引言

关系数据库是一种广泛应用于数据存储和管理的技术,它基于关系模型,通过表格的形式来组织和存储数据,并提供了一系列强大的操作和查询语言,使得数据的管理和处理变得更加高效和灵活,在关系数据库中,数据之间存在着一定的关系,这些关系具有一些重要的性质,这些性质对于数据库的设计、实现和使用都有着至关重要的影响,本文将详细介绍关系数据库中关系的性质,并探讨它们的重要性。

二、关系数据库的性质

1、数据一致性:关系数据库中的数据必须满足一定的一致性约束,在一个学生关系中,学生的学号必须是唯一的,学生的姓名和年龄必须是合法的,这些一致性约束可以通过数据库的设计和实现来保证,确保数据库中的数据是准确和可靠的。

2、数据完整性:关系数据库中的数据必须满足一定的完整性约束,在一个学生关系中,学生的学号和姓名必须是完整的,不能存在缺失值,这些完整性约束可以通过数据库的设计和实现来保证,确保数据库中的数据是完整和可用的。

3、数据独立性:关系数据库中的数据应该具有一定的独立性,即数据的存储和表示应该与应用程序的逻辑和实现相分离,这样可以使得数据库的设计和实现更加灵活和可维护,同时也可以提高应用程序的可移植性和可扩展性。

4、数据安全性:关系数据库中的数据应该具有一定的安全性,即只有授权的用户才能访问和操作数据库中的数据,这样可以保护数据库中的敏感信息,防止数据泄露和滥用。

5、数据冗余性低:关系数据库中的数据应该尽量减少冗余性,即相同的数据应该只存储在一个地方,这样可以节省存储空间,提高数据的一致性和完整性,同时也可以提高数据库的查询和更新效率。

6、数据一致性维护:关系数据库中的数据应该具有一定的一致性维护机制,即当数据库中的数据发生变化时,应该自动地更新相关的数据,以保证数据的一致性,这样可以避免数据不一致性的出现,提高数据库的可靠性和稳定性。

三、关系数据库性质的重要性

1、保证数据的准确性和可靠性:关系数据库中的数据必须满足一定的一致性和完整性约束,这样可以保证数据的准确性和可靠性,如果数据库中的数据存在不一致性或完整性问题,可能会导致应用程序出现错误或异常,甚至会影响到企业的正常运营。

2、提高数据的可用性和可维护性:关系数据库中的数据应该具有一定的独立性和安全性,这样可以提高数据的可用性和可维护性,如果数据库中的数据与应用程序的逻辑和实现紧密耦合,那么当应用程序需要修改或扩展时,就需要对数据库进行相应的修改,这会增加数据库的维护成本和难度。

3、提高数据的查询和更新效率:关系数据库中的数据应该尽量减少冗余性,这样可以提高数据的查询和更新效率,如果数据库中的数据存在大量的冗余,那么在查询和更新数据时就需要进行大量的重复操作,这会降低数据库的查询和更新效率。

4、保证数据的安全性:关系数据库中的数据应该具有一定的安全性,这样可以保护数据库中的敏感信息,防止数据泄露和滥用,如果数据库中的数据没有得到有效的保护,那么就可能会导致企业的商业机密泄露,给企业带来巨大的损失。

四、结论

关系数据库是一种广泛应用于数据存储和管理的技术,它具有数据一致性、数据完整性、数据独立性、数据安全性、数据冗余性低和数据一致性维护等重要性质,这些性质对于数据库的设计、实现和使用都有着至关重要的影响,在实际应用中,我们应该根据具体的需求和情况,合理地设计和使用关系数据库,以充分发挥其优势,提高数据管理和处理的效率和质量。

标签: #关系数据库 #关系性质

黑狐家游戏
  • 评论列表

留言评论